管理Oracle以信息驱动管理 遨游新前程(oracle信息驱动)
管理Oracle:以信息驱动管理 遨游新前程
Oracle作为一款广泛应用的关系型数据库管理系统,其在数据存储、数据处理和数据整合等方面发挥着重要的作用。然而,Oracle本身的复杂性和应用范围的广泛性,也给数据库管理人员带来很多挑战。
为了优化数据库管理,提高数据库的性能和安全性,管理者需要了解并掌握各种Oracle的管理技巧。而“信息驱动管理”则成为了一种新的管理思路与方法,使数据库管理员可以更加高效地管理Oracle数据库。
所谓“信息驱动管理”,即通过数据采集、模型分析和应用展示等环节,将复杂的数据进行组织与管理,以达到优化管理和提高执行力的目的。
在Oracle数据库管理中,数据采集是非常重要的一环节。管理员可以通过性能监测工具,如AWR(自动工作负载库存储库)或ASH(Active Session History)对Oracle数据库做全面的性能评估;可以通过日志记录工具,如LogMiner、CDC(Change Data Capture)或GoldenGate等,实现细粒度的变更数据抓取和监控。
随后,通过数据模型分析,可以基于采集所获取的数据,深入分析数据库性能瓶颈、优化策略和风险评估等。比如,在分析AwR报告中的SQL语句执行情况时,管理员可以运用SQL调优技巧,对SQL语句的执行计划、索引优化、绑定变量使用、SQL语句重构等方面做出相应的优化策略。
而在风险评估方面,则可以通过Oracle数据库审计功能进行审计,并生成报告。管理员可以结合相关的安全标准和自身业务规则,对审计结果进行风险评估和漏洞披露。
应用展示是对以上工作的结果进行整合和展示,以便于管理员对Oracle数据库的实时监控和管理。比如,可以基于Oracle EM(Enterprise Manager)实现动态仪表盘展示、操作导航和报警等功能。也可以借助第三方报告工具,如JasperReports、BI Publisher等,实现非高级用户自助报告的制作和输出。
此外,为了提高“信息驱动管理”的效能,还需要借助自动化工具,如shell脚本、SQL脚本等,实现无人值守的定时任务执行和监控。
Oracle数据库管理是一项非常复杂的工作,但通过“信息驱动管理”方法的系统应用,管理员可以更加高效地管理和优化Oracle数据库,从而有效提高数据库的性能和安全性。